Bobbins occupies a small shopfront at 25 Steeple Street in Kilbarchan, close to the National Trust for Scotland's Weaver's Cottage and the village's Steeple landmark. The café serves homemade soup made daily, sandwiches made to order and handcrafted cakes, alongside a retail corner selling greetings cards, small crafts and paintings by local artists, giving the shop a dual role as café and outlet for local makers. The café is small, with limited seating, and regulars note that booking ahead is worthwhile at busier times. Well-behaved dogs are allowed inside. The business trades mornings into early afternoon, in keeping with the rhythm of a village high street rather than an evening venue. It sits within Kilbarchan's conservation area, a former weaving village whose historic core now supports a small cluster of independent shops and cafés, of which Bobbins' cards-and-crafts counter is one.
